pyflakes fails to build with Python 3.13.0b1. =================================== FAILURES =================================== _____________________ IntegrationTests.test_errors_syntax ______________________ self = <pyflakes.test.test_api.IntegrationTests testMethod=test_errors_syntax> def test_errors_syntax(self): """ When pyflakes finds errors with the files it's given, (if they don't exist, say), then the return code is non-zero and the errors are printed to stderr. """ with open(self.tempfilepath, 'wb') as fd: fd.write(b"import") d = self.runPyflakes([self.tempfilepath]) error_msg = '{0}:1:7: invalid syntax{1}import{1} ^{1}'.format( self.tempfilepath, os.linesep) > self.assertEqual(d, ('', error_msg, 1)) E AssertionError: Tuples differ: ('', "/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: Expected one [47 chars]", 1) != ('', '/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: invalid synta[20 chars]', 1) E E First differing element 1: E "/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: Expected one [43 chars] ^\n" E '/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: invalid synta[16 chars] ^\n' E E + ('', '/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: invalid syntax\nimport\n ^\n', 1) E - ('', E - "/tmp/tmpwh8ow2pz/temp:1:7: Expected one or more names after 'import'\n" E - 'import\n' E - ' ^\n', E - 1) pyflakes/test/test_api.py:779: AssertionError _________________________ TestMain.test_errors_syntax __________________________ self = <pyflakes.test.test_api.TestMain testMethod=test_errors_syntax> def test_errors_syntax(self): """ When pyflakes finds errors with the files it's given, (if they don't exist, say), then the return code is non-zero and the errors are printed to stderr. """ with open(self.tempfilepath, 'wb') as fd: fd.write(b"import") d = self.runPyflakes([self.tempfilepath]) error_msg = '{0}:1:7: invalid syntax{1}import{1} ^{1}'.format( self.tempfilepath, os.linesep) > self.assertEqual(d, ('', error_msg, 1)) E AssertionError: Tuples differ: ('', "/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: Expected one [47 chars]", 1) != ('', '/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: invalid synta[20 chars]', 1) E E First differing element 1: E "/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: Expected one [43 chars] ^\n" E '/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: invalid synta[16 chars] ^\n' E E + ('', '/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: invalid syntax\nimport\n ^\n', 1) E - ('', E - "/tmp/tmph2zjmdt6/temp:1:7: Expected one or more names after 'import'\n" E - 'import\n' E - ' ^\n', E - 1) pyflakes/test/test_api.py:779: AssertionError =========================== short test summary info ============================ FAILED pyflakes/test/test_api.py::IntegrationTests::test_errors_syntax - Asse... FAILED pyflakes/test/test_api.py::TestMain::test_errors_syntax - AssertionErr... ================== 2 failed, 712 passed, 14 skipped in 1.52s =================== https://docs.python.org/3.13/whatsnew/3.13.html For the build logs, see: https://copr-be.cloud.fedoraproject.org/results/@python/python3.13/fedora-rawhide-x86_64/07433947-pyflakes/ For all our attempts to build pyflakes with Python 3.13, see: https://copr.fedorainfracloud.org/coprs/g/python/python3.13/package/pyflakes/ Testing and mass rebuild of packages is happening in copr. Python 3.13 is planned to be included in Fedora 41. To make that update smoother, we're building Fedora packages with all pre-releases of Python 3.13. A build failure prevents us from testing all dependent packages (transitive [Build]Requires), so if this package is required a lot, it's important for us to get it fixed soon.
